Understanding the Core Mechanics of the Chicken Road Game

At its heart, the ‘chicken road’ game is a form of escalating risk. Imagine a path with segments, each offering an increased multiplier to your initial bet. With each step the chicken takes along the road, the potential payout grows exponentially. However, lurking within the path are hazards – traps, pitfalls, or other unexpected setbacks. Landing on one of these hazards results in the loss of all accumulated winnings, forcing you to start anew. This delicate balance between risk and reward is the central element defining the experience.

The skill lies in correctly assessing when to “cash out” – to secure your current winnings before the risk becomes too great. Successful players demonstrate an understanding of probability and the ability to resist the temptation of pursuing ever-larger, yet increasingly improbable, payouts. It’s a mental duel between greed and prudence, a constant evaluation of potential gains against likely losses.

The Importance of Bankroll Management

Effective bankroll management is paramount in any form of gambling, and the ‘chicken road’ is no exception. Setting a budget and adhering to it is crucial for preventing significant losses. This involves determining how much you’re willing to risk before starting and avoiding the temptation to chase losses by increasing your bets. Responsible gambling always prioritizes affordability and recognizes that occasional losses are an inherent part of the process.

Thinking of your bankroll as a resource to be preserved, rather than simply money to be won, fosters a more cautious and sustainable approach to the game. Players should also diversify their bets, as putting all your money in a game that depends on chance can lead to losses.

Understanding the House Edge

Like all casino games, the ‘chicken road’ incorporates a house edge – a statistical advantage that ensures the operator generates a profit over the long run. While the exact house edge can vary depending on the specific implementation of the game, it’s essential to acknowledge its existence. This understanding should temper expectations and promote a realistic approach to playing, recognizing that the odds are inherently stacked against the player. It is crucial to be aware that a longer game will almost certainly lead to loss.

Being aware of risk and the long term average loss is essential to enjoying the game with an understanding of the odds.

The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)

The fairness and integrity of the ‘chicken road’ game rely heavily on the use of Random Number Generators (RNGs). These algorithms ensure that the outcome of each step is truly random and unpredictable. Reputable gaming platforms utilize certified RNGs that are regularly audited by independent agencies to verify their fairness. This provides assurance that the game is not rigged and that all players have an equal chance of winning.

The RNG determines when hazards occur, ensuring they’re truly random and not manipulated. Transparency in RNG certification is a hallmark of a trustworthy gaming environment.
